Hi.. I Have a Brava 1999 (V) 1.2.

Head Gasket went over xmas.. Have repaired it myself, but when putting the rocker cover back on, it doesn't fit flush to the head. Also is there any timing marks as I can't see any.

Any advice welcome.

Hi there. I have been doing exactly the same job on a car with the same engine and age. Strictly speaking these engines dont have a rocker box cover, it is called a 'head extension'. I houses the valves so it wont sit straight on the head as it needs to be clamped down to push the valves that are rocking and opening etc for the head cycle, MAKE SURE THE ENGINE IS NOT AT TDC BEFORE YOU DO BOLT THIS DOWN. I bolted the two end bolts down first and then the rest in a circular motion. The are no timing marks for these engines. Timing them is a bit awkward, I am assuming you did not mark the position on top and bottom toothed gears when you took the belt off. If not then full engine timing must be done. It's not hard just needs to be correctly done. I can run you through this as I have done it loads of times on mine. See my ID for othr threads as I have had a few problems.
